Ukraine meat output up 25.5 percent
Ukraine's meat output in live weight grew 25.5 percent on the month and 3.7 percent on-year to 258,700 tonnes in April, according to the State Statistics Committee.
Local family farms increased meat output by 53.6 percent on the month to 51,300 tonnes, while livestock farms reported a 1.1 percent growth in total output to 111,600 tonnes.
Ukraine's meat output reached 955,200 tonnes in the first quarter, up 3.4 percent on-year. The country produced 206,200 tonnes of meat in March, down 2.7 percent from February.
Ukraine's meat production was 2.76 million tonnes for the whole of 2007, up 8.4 percent from 2006.
